ADVISORY - DAUPHIN COUNTY - Governor Shapiro to Visit Harrisburg Bureau of Fire, Celebrate 40 Percent Increase in Funding for Capital City First Responders

Governor Josh Shapiro will join firefighters, local leaders, and elected officials at the Harrisburg Bureau of Fire's Station #1 to highlight critical investments the 2025-26 budget makes in firefighters in the Commonwealth's capital city.

The Harrisburg Bureau of Fire was the primary fire service agency that responded after the arson attack on the Governor's Residence. Governor Shapiro and his family thanked firefighters and first responders earlier this year, and is returning to celebrate the additional $2 million in annual funding delivered in this new budget, bringing the total state funding to $7 million per year.
